Signs of Wind Damage on Roofs: Unraveling the Clues


The first step to embarking on a journey towards a new and secure roof is to identify the signs of wind damage. Imagine you're Sherlock Holmes, but instead of solving mysteries, you're discovering the subtle hints left by powerful gusts.


Curled shingles, loose granules in the gutter, or even exposed areas where shingles used to be are all clues that wind damage has paid a visit. Don your detective cap and let's examine the scene together.

Insurance Claims for Wind Damaged Roofs: Navigating the Paper Trail


Insurance can be your ally in this battle against wind damage. Before the storm, make sure your policy covers wind damage, as this can differ based on your location and policy specifics.


Document the damage meticulously, with photographs and detailed notes. Your insurer will appreciate your diligence, and it will expedite the claims process. Remember, the aim is to restore your roof and your peace of mind.


Wind Damage Roof Inspection Guide: Your DIY Defender


Equip yourself with knowledge, for it's a powerful ally. When inspecting your roof, start from the ground and scan for any visible damage using binoculars. Look for missing shingles, granule loss, or even cracked flashing.


Check for any debris or branches that might have found a resting place on your roof. Inside your home, be vigilant for water stains or leaks that might have found their way through weakened spots.

FAQs


How do I know if my roof has wind damage?


Curled shingles, exposed areas, and loose granules in gutters are common signs of wind damage. However, it's best to have a professional inspection to accurately assess the extent.


Will my insurance cover wind damage to my roof?


Many homeowners insurance policies do cover wind damage. Contact your insurance provider to understand your coverage and how to file a claim.


How long does it take to replace a roof after wind damage?


The timeline varies depending on the scope of the project and weather conditions. A professional roofing contractor can provide you with a more accurate estimate.


What materials are best for wind-resistant roofs?


Materials like asphalt shingles, metal roofing, and synthetic tiles are known for their wind resistance. Discuss your options with a roofing expert to determine the best fit for your home.


How can I prevent wind damage to my roof in the future?


Regular maintenance, proper installation, and choosing durable materials can help reduce the risk of wind damage. Work with roofing professionals to ensure your roof is properly prepared.
